Taking on Six-Strings : Your First Steps
So you're ready to learn the guitar? Awesome! It's a adventure in musical expression that can bring countless joy. Your first steps might seem daunting at first, but with the proper guidance, you'll be picking melodies in no time.
- Kick off your journey with tuning your guitar. It might appear as a hassle, but it's vital for producing good sound.
- Get acquainted with key chords. C, G, D, Em, and Am are your best friends at the onset of your guitar journey.
- Dedicate yourself to consistent practice, even if it's just 15 minutes a day.
Keep in mind, persistence is key. Don't get frustrated by challenges. Every guitar player was a check here novice at some point just like you.
